Best High Schools in Tiffin, MO

Tiffin, MO has 2 high schools with 508 students. Below are the top high schools based on their actual test performance displayed alongside our projected performance for their socioeconomic status and the Teacher Grade we assign based on expected performance. On average, high schools in Tiffin score 31% on their proficiency tests, and we project and average score of 35%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, high schools in Tiffin don't me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Tiffin, MO

City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.

Community Factors

Tiffin, MO has a total population of 274 with 15%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 95%, and 7%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
